Types of Welding Certificates

Despite the fact that the AWS’ standard CW certificate paves the way for most positions, some industries will require their certain certificate. Several of the most-well-known of these are highlighted below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those who work on boiler and pressure vessels
  • CW Certificates to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for welders who work on pipelines in the energy industry
  • CWI and SCWI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ors

Overview of Welding Programs

There are a few matters you should look at whenever you are ready to choose between certified welding schools. It might feel as if there are dozens of welding programs in Newton Highlands, MA, however you still need to select the training course that can best lead you towards your career aspirations. We simply cannot stress too much the significance of the program you finally choose being accredited and accepted by the AWS. If the program is endorsed by these agencies, you really should also check out several other areas including:

  • Watch for schools that satisfy AWS SENSE standards
  • Be sure the program teaches on tools that matches the latest industry specifications
  • See if the school provides financial assistance
  • Make sure that the college’s program offers training in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
